NJOKU, REINSTATED APGA NATIONAL CHAIRMAN LEADS PARTY’S NWC TO EMOTIONAL REUNION WITH CHEKWAS OKORIE, PARTY’S FOUNDER, PIONEER NATIONAL CHAIRMAN



Enugu: Chief Edozie Njoku, the reinstated National Chairman of the All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A), on Saturday, led members of the party’s National Working Committee (NWC) to the Enugu residence of its founder and pioneer National Chairman, Chief Chekwas Okorie, Ojeozi Ndigbo, for an emotional reunion.
Njoku, who was recently affirmed as the authentic National Chairman of the party by the Supreme Court, expressed regret that Chief Okorie was unjustly pushed out of the party for many years after all the pains and sacrifices he passed through in conceiving and eventually getting the party registered by the Independent National Electoral Commission, INEC. He however, appealed to him to return to the party, saying “we are here today to say we are truly sorry for all the injustices you suffered in a party you formed.
Njoku, who holds the revered chieftaincy title of Onwa Ibeku stated that he felt emotional when he saw Okorie and other founding members of the party who contributed immensely to the growth of the party in the past.
“When I saw some people here , I realised the setback APGA has suffered. We are here with selected members of NWC to say we are sorry for all the injustice you suffered in the party.“APGA is your baby, please come back to your home. Please forgive us from the bottom of your heart.
“This is your family, so please come back to the home you built. From the bottom of my heart, I am saying please come back, sir”.
The Mbaise born business magnate and founding member of APGA seized the opportunity to call on all Stakeholders of the party to join hands with him in rebuilding the party.
He assured Okorie, that APGA under his watch would continue to pursue the dream of the pioneer national Chairman, who has joined the ruling All progressive Congress APC after his defunct United peoples party UPP was deregistered by the Independent National Electoral Commission INEC.
“Whenever I see Chekwas Okorie and see APC, I take two steps backwards”, Njoku said, explaining that it was an aberration for Chekwas Okorie to have been pushed out of APGA, a party synonymous with his name to join APC.
Responding, Chief Okorie, said he was very happy to recite the slogan of APGA after a long time, adding that the visit was really emotional.
He said : “I am a bit emotional with the nature of this visit. Even if I have a heart of stone, you have melted my heart. God has rescued APGA and the days of the locusts is over.
According to him, the incumbent national chairman, APGA was not just a foundation member of APGA but that he was as well part of Igboezuo socio-cultural organization, where APGA was conceptualized.“We are going to build back APGA but if we must succeed in this second missionary journey, we must be careful with dangerous people.
I will consider what you have requested of me favorably.I” will consult with those who stood by me throughout the locust days. I will not keep you waiting for a long time. Nigerians will hear from me very soon.” he assured the elated gathering of party stalwarts.
Okorie who went down memory lane on how the party was formed, said APGA was a victim of political brigandage caused by political buccaneers and a victim of political kidnapping.
He as well urged Njoku, the National Chairman to avoid some former leaders of the party who he described as “a virus”
Okorie equally recalled the sacrifice made by the National Chairman, Njoku, at the early stage of the party, “Njoku, was in 2002,the National Vice Chairman of APGA, South East. However, I pleaded with him to give up his seat to Victor Umeh, in the spirit of reconciliation to strengthen the party and he humbly complied”
Former National Chairman of the party Victor Oye was sacked recently by the Supreme Court, affirming Njoku as the authentic helmsman of the party.
